Top Birds at Cranberry Lake Preserve in May
relative to other locations within 25 miles of New York, NY, USA

based on 251 checklists

This page shows the probability of a species appearing on a checklist at Cranberry Lake Preserve in May. The difference in probability relative to other nearby locations is also shown, to highlight which birds are particularly likely to be found (or not found) at this specific location.
